[0002] At present, in primary hospitals, neuroendoscopy is more and more widely used and has become an indispensable surgical tool. Ventricular hemorrhage is a common acute and severe disease of the nervous system. Among them, ventricular system hemorrhage casting is a kind of Common type, easy to cause acute severe hydrocephalus, has a high fatality rate, needs hematoma evacuation for treatment, and for this type of operation, the surgical channel is our first problem to be solved, the existing technology also provides a flexible brain expansion The flexible brain tissue retraction can be achieved by inflating the balloon, and then the tubular brain compression plate is inserted into the brain tissue following the balloon to establish a brain channel. However, in the process of establishing the brain channel, due to the The length is far smaller than the length of the required brain channel, and the balloon needs to be expanded and advanced many times to complete the entire brain channel. Repeated expansion and contraction of the balloon makes it gradually advance, making it time-consuming and laborious to complete the placement of the entire tubular brain compression plate
Moreover, moving and expanding in this way not only tends to cause lateral stretching injury to the brain tissue, but also easily causes longitudinal stretching injury to the brain tissue. Repeated operations also increase the entire operation time, which is not conducive to the smooth progress of the operation.

Abstract

The invention discloses a soft channel for endoscopic neurosurgery. The soft channel includes an air bag and is characterized in that the air bag includes an inner wall and an outer wall; an enclosedcavity is formed between the inner wall and the outer wall and connected to a conveying assembly; the center of the air bag is provided with a cavity; a screw rod is arranged in the cavity; one end ofthe screw rod is exposed out of the air bag, and the other end of the screw rod is provided with an endoscope; the screw rod is provided with a contraction ring used for contracting the air bag; andthe end, close to the endoscope, of the air bag is provided with a transparent film. Through the air bag, the screw rod, the contraction ring, a conveying device and other structures, the channel thatcan reach ventricles with minimal trauma and can realize the continuous internal and external communication of the ventricles and the establishing method thereof can be provided.
